Synopsis:

Adapted from the play by Tennessee Williams, Glass Menagerie centers around four unhappy people living in a rundown section of St. Louis. Tom, the story's narrator (Arthur Kennedy) is a poetic idealist trapped in a dead-end job, drowning his sorrows in booze. Tom lives with his mother Amanda (Gertrude Lawrence), a faded Southern belle who lives in the past, and with his crippled older sister Laura (Jane Wyman), an intensely shy woman who escapes from reality by keeping a "glass menagerie" of small animal figures.

Movie Details:

  • Director: Irving Rapper
  • Studio: Warner Brothers
  • Year: 1950
  • Run Time: 106 minutes
  • Country: USA
  • Language: English
  • Category: Feature
  • Genre/Type: Drama
  • Filmed in: B&W
